A simultaneous microdetermination of iron and copper at sub-mug/L level by solid phase derivative spectrophotometry has been developed. A microdetermination of iron at sub-mg/L level by derivative spectrophotometry has been developed. The compound TPTZ (2,4,6-tripyridyl-1,3,5-triazine) was used as chromogenic reagent to form a blue complex (pH = 5.0), which is fixed and concentrated on a cation-exchange resin sp sephadex C-25. The structures of [Cu(en)(H2O)2]SO4 (I), [Cu(en)2](NO3)2 (II) and [Cu(trien)I]I (III) have been determined by single crystal X-ray diffraction. ComplexI is monoclinic, space group C2/c, with unit cell parametera=7.232(1),b=11.725(2),c=9.768(1), β=105.50(1)°, andZ=4.
